Predict the boiling points of the following compounds at the pressure indicated.
(a) water at 745 mm Hg
(b) dichloromethane (bp 40˚ at 760 mm) at 737 mm
(c) benzene (bp 80˚ at 760 mm) at 765 mm
(a) bp = 100˚ - [(0.5˚ / (10 mm x 15 mm)] = 99.25˚, or about 99˚
(b) 39.85, or about 40˚
(c) 80.25˚, or about 80˚
2
Using the nomograph in Figure 7.6, approximate the boiling points of the following sub- stances at atmospheric pressure (760 mm Hg).
(a) rotenone, bp 210˚ (0.5 mm Hg)
(b) 1,6-hexanediol, bp 132˚ (9 mm Hg)
(a) about 500˚ at 760 mm Hg
(b) about 270˚ at 760 mm Hg
3
Approximate the boiling points of the compounds in problem 7.2 at 25 mm Hg.
(a) 340˚ at 25 mm Hg
(b) 170˚ at 25 mm Hg
